Oddball brace, goes from hood hinge to cowl??
Does anyone have bracing from their hood hinge to the cowl? I bought that 82-92 Camaro Performance book, by David Shelby, and one of the cars has them. (That's the only thing I picked up from the book... it's more of a good book for beginners.) I haven't seen an f-body with those braces yet! For those that don't have 'em, here's what I'm talking about:
Notice on the bottom part of the hood hinges, towards the engine, there's a piece of the hinge that curves out, and there's a hole there. Well, in the picture, there's a thin bar that bolts here. The bolt goes backward at an angle to a matching hole on the lip of the cowl, above the firewall.
The metal looks too small to be of structural help, so what's it for, and why haven't I seen it until now? Was it an early model piece that GM stopped using? Or am I looking at cars that had the pieces removed by previous owners??

Some have it, some don't. My '89 Formula 350 did not have it when I bought it 7 years ago w/25K miles. My friend had a '91 Formula 350 that had it.
I see them in the junkyard every so often. I do not think they really do anything.
